Maghull Train Station is a convenient gateway to the vibrant region of Merseyside in northern England. Located approximately 9 miles north-east of Liverpool, it serves as a vital hub for commuters and travelers seeking to explore everything the area has to offer. The station is equipped with essential amenities to enhance your travel experience. You'll find a ticket office that operates from early morning until midnight, ensuring you can conveniently purchase or collect rail tickets. While the ticket machines and smartcard validators facilitate a quick and efficient service, note that there's no accessible ticket machine at the station, but assistance is available. If you require staff assistance, the friendly team at the ticket office can help. Just remember, there’s no luggage storage service here.
Maghull Station is fully equipped with CCTV for your safety, and for those needing Accessible Toilets, you're in luck. There’s no ATM or shop offering refreshments, but you will find vending facilities with cold drinks available to quench your thirst. Whether you’re a daily commuter or an occasional traveler, the comfortable seating areas and waiting rooms are open for you to relax while you wait for your train.
The station proudly boasts step-free access to ensure an inclusive travel experience for everyone. With 12 accessible parking spaces in the car park area, mobility-impaired travelers can easily navigate the station. However, if you're in need of a taxi, be aware there’s no taxi rank, and although bike riders can securely store their bikes, there is no shelter at the storage stands. For broader travel connections, Maghull makes the bus services and the nearest airport, Liverpool John Lennon Airport, easily reachable. Simply utilize the convenient Rail/bus ticket service to book your airport journey. Alternatively, Travelers can always explore Merseyrail's services directly.

Camberley Station comes equipped with essential amenities to ensure a smooth travel experience. For those needing tickets, the ticket office is open during the weekday mornings and longer hours on Saturdays. Ticket machines for self-service are conveniently placed and allow collections for tickets purchased online. Accessibility is a priority here, with all machines able to process Disabled Persons Railcard discounts.
The station provides step-free access from both platforms, including an accessible toilet on Platform 1. While there are no waiting room facilities, there is ample seating available for your comfort. Don’t forget accessibility support is available on the train itself, provided by friendly on-board guards. For cycle enthusiasts, 28 bicycle storage spaces are available, though these are not sheltered.
Camberley station is well-linked with various transportation options, easing the transition from rail to road. For those in need of a bus, notable stops for rail replacement services guide travelers to nearby destinations including Ascot and Aldershot. Detailed travel information is also accessible via a printable format from the National Rail site, making it easy to plan your journey in advance whether you're traveling within Camberley or beyond.
